Passengers on SpiceJet flight SG 105 [1] protested after an air-conditioning failure made the cabin unbearably hot during a trip from Delhi to Pune.

The incident highlights growing concerns over aircraft maintenance and passenger safety within the regional aviation sector. When climate control systems fail in high-temperature environments, cabins can quickly become hazardous for travelers and crew.

The flight departed from Indira Gandhi International Airport in Delhi [1], [2], [3]. According to reports, a technical snag disabled the aircraft's air-conditioning system [1], [2]. This failure caused temperatures inside the plane to rise significantly, leading passengers to describe the environment as a "gas chamber" [1], [3].

There were more than 100 [1] passengers on board the aircraft. As the heat became oppressive, those on board began to protest the conditions. The situation escalated as travelers expressed frustration over the lack of cooling and the perceived lack of immediate resolution to the technical issue [2], [3].

SpiceJet has not provided a detailed public breakdown of the specific mechanical failure that led to the outage. However, the reports indicate that the malfunction occurred while the plane was operating the route toward Pune Airport [1], [2], [3].

The incident was captured in videos shared by passengers, showing the distress of those trapped in the heat. The protest centered on the airline's failure to maintain a habitable cabin temperature, a basic requirement for passenger transport during the summer months.
